      Meaning of the first name Ednora

      Origin

      English, modern invention

      Meaning

      Wealthy and prosperous.
      The name Ednora is a relatively rare feminine given name that has garnered attention for its melodic sound and unique composition. Its origins can be traced back to various linguistic and cultural backgrounds, although it is most commonly associated with the English-speaking world. Ednora is believed to be a blend of the name Edna, which has Hebrew roots meaning "pleasure" or "delight," and the suffix "-ora," which is derived from Latin and means "light" or "golden." This combination of meanings suggests a connotation of joyful brightness or delightful illumination.

      Historically, the name Edna has seen more widespread use and recognition, particularly in the early to mid-20th century, largely in the United States. Edna was popularized by notable figures and characters in literature, which may have led to the creation of variants like Ednora. The use of "-ora" as a suffix is also common in various names across different cultures, which may contribute to the adoption of Ednora in diverse communities. However, specific historical records regarding the use of Ednora itself are limited, and it does not appear to have been widely documented in historical texts or name registries.
